There's no such thing as adjusting disc brakes. Until the pads are seated, they will not hold as well as the seated pads that you removed.

The other thing that would make the pedal feel different would be air in the hydraulic system. Since you only replaced pads and rotors and did not open the hydraulic system, this should not have changed.

You are flushing your hydraulic system annually aren't you. If not, then when you moved the pistons in their bores, you might have forced the seals over some crud. Annual flushing will eliminate the crud.

Is the fluid clear looking in the reservoir?
